The main difference is that the US release exists, and the UK release doesn't
![]() Paramount hold the distribution rights to Deadwood in the UK, as opposed to Warner Home Video in the US, so there's really no telling if or when it'll ever be released here. I'd imagine this difference in distributors is also the reason the UK DVDs didn't have any extras (I'm guessing the US extras weren't licensed to Paramount), and why the US Blu-ray is Region A locked (to discourage importing into territories where Paramount are responsible for the releases.)
